SNCR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review

222 of the 3,583 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Synchronoss Technologies (SNCR)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$1.34B — down 24% from $1.76B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 39 funds closed out of SNCR and 35 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 49 trimmed existing stakes and 116 added.

The largest buyer was LMCG Investments, adding an estimated $33.6M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$71M.
